About Y.-N. Chin

Y.-N. Chin is a scholar working on Astronomy and Astrophysics, Spectroscopy, Atmospheric Science, Nuclear and High Energy Physics and History and Philosophy of Science, having authored 17 papers that have together received 267 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Astrophysics and Star Formation Studies (14 papers), Molecular Spectroscopy and Structure (8 papers), Stellar, planetary, and galactic studies (7 papers), Atmospheric Ozone and Climate (4 papers), Spectroscopy and Laser Applications (3 papers), Galaxies: Formation, Evolution, Phenomena (3 papers), Astrophysics and Cosmic Phenomena (2 papers) and Astro and Planetary Science (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Astronomy and Astrophysics (244 citations), Spectroscopy (84 citations), Atmospheric Science (50 citations), Nuclear and High Energy Physics (21 citations) and Fluid Flow and Transfer Processes (8 citations). Y.-N. Chin has collaborated with scholars based in Taiwan, Germany and Australia. Frequent co-authors include C. Henkel, J. B. Whiteoak, Maria Cunningham, M. Wang, R. Mauersberger, D. Muders, Yi Huang, K. M. Menten, А. Беллоче and J. S. Zhang. Their work appears in journals such as The Astrophysical Journal, Astronomy and Astrophysics, Nature, University of Groningen research database (University of Groningen / Centre for Information Technology) and arXiv (Cornell University).
